This information applies to all e-mail clients, including most smartphones. You have two choices in terms of the type of e-mail protocol to use - POP or IMAP.
Regardless of the e-mail client or protocol you use, the basic mail server settings are the same. For each program, you are required to enter:
The incoming (POP or IMAP) mail server name: pop.mydomain.com
The outgoing (SMTP) mail server name: smtp.mydomain.com
The E-mail account user name: myaddress@mydomain.com (the full Email address)
The E-mail account password: (the password you select when creating the email account)
Using our test domain, testdomain.com, the settings would be:
The incoming (POP or IMAP) mail server name: pop.testdomain.com
The outgoing (SMTP) mail server name: smtp.testdomain.com
The E-mail account user name: mary@testdomain.com
The E-mail account password: (the password that was selected for this account)
You can also find the exact settings for email by logging in to SiteControl and clicking on the Edit option next to any email address. The settings then appear in the Edit Email Address page.
